Get AI-powered advice on this job and more exclusive features. Direct message the job poster from Ditech Group People Manager | IT Recruiter | Tech Hunter +3 years of experience Modality: Relocation to Spain. Advanced English (C1) Specific Knowledge and Skills: Description: The position requires expertise in time series forecasting, model monitoring, and Python programming, with a strong emphasis on object-oriented programming (OOP) principles. The role involves contributing to the development and deployment of forecasting models, ensuring model reliability, and maintaining high standards of code quality. Collaboration with cross-functional teams and the ability to work within existing codebases are essential components of the role. Service This role focuses on the development and deployment of time series forecasting models and the application of object-oriented programming principles in Python. Responsibilities include implementing scalable forecasting solutions, monitoring model performance using key metrics, and contributing to the maintainability and evolution of the codebase. The position requires collaboration with cross-functional teams and the ability to work with existing code structures while ensuring high standards of code quality and documentation. Responsibilities: • Design, develop, and deploy time series forecasting models for business-critical applications. • Monitor model performance using relevant KPIs and ensure long-term accuracy and reliability. • Conduct feature engineering and selection using statistical and machine learning techniques. • Collaborate with cross-functional teams to integrate models into production environments. • Write clean, maintainable, and scalable Python code using OOP best practices. • Participate in code reviews and contribute to the evolution of the codebase. • Document processes, models, and decisions clearly for both technical and non-technical stakeholders. Qualifications: Must Have: • Proven experience with time series forecasting (e.g., ARIMA, Prophet, LSTM, etc.). • Strong proficiency in Python, including OOP principles. • Experience with model evaluation metrics (e.g., MAE, RMSE, MAPE) and model tracking in production. • Familiarity with abstract classes, interfaces, and design patterns in Python. • Experience with feature selection techniques and hyperparameter tuning. • Ability to work with and adapt to existing codebases. • Strong communication skills and ability to explain technical concepts clearly. Nice to Have: • Experience with international or cross-cultural teams. • Experience with MLFlow, GitHub, and Snowflake. • Exposure to cloud platforms (AWS, GCP, Azure) for model deployment. • Knowledge of serialization techniques (e.g., pickle, joblib) and alternatives. 100% work from home is allowed (in Spain) Seniority level Seniority level Mid-Senior level Employment type Employment type Full-time Job function Job function Information Technology Industries IT Services and IT Consulting Referrals increase your chances of interviewing at Ditech Group by 2x Sign in to set job alerts for “Data Scientist” roles. Bogota, D.C., Capital District, Colombia 2 days ago Bogota, D.C., Capital District, Colombia 1 month ago Bogota, D.C., Capital District, Colombia 4 weeks ago Medellin, Antioquia, Colombia 1 month ago Bogota, D.C., Capital District, Colombia 1 day ago Data Scientist - Online Behavioral Analytics & Generative AI Bogota, D.C., Capital District, Colombia 2 months ago Bogota, D.C., Capital District, Colombia 1 day ago Bogota, D.C., Capital District, Colombia 8 months ago Artificial Intelligence / Machine Learning specialist Bogota, D.C., Capital District, Colombia 1 week ago Bogota, D.C., Capital District, Colombia 1 month ago Senior Data Engineer with Data Science/MLOps background Bogota, D.C., Capital District, Colombia 2 weeks ago We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I. #J-18808-Ljbffr